Ermmm, nope. Almost all uPVC windows in the UK are beaded on the inside (as per the video), meaning only the internal beading is removable. The outside of the frame might look similar to the inside but it's a solid entity i.e. non-removable.

Easy instruction but should always put the bottom beading in first it holds the unit down onto the packers when the top beading is being located also for any diy folks it’s helps if you lube the beading gasket as this stops resistance on the glass.

Question ,,if a frame is e,g, 1000 mm x 1000 mm ,,whar size of pane do you order ,,995 x 995 or 990 x 990 ? What gap should you have ? Hope this makes sense, im a DIYr only 👍
@pierreneedham92466 ай бұрын
Watch his other video which shows you how to measure.
@markcross19626 ай бұрын
Take 3 measurements for the width, 3 for the height across 3 different points. Then subtract 10mm from the smallest measurement for height and width.
